Threshold production of the Theta^+ in a polarized proton reaction

We compute cross sections of $\Theta^+$ production near threshold for a polarized proton reaction, $\vec p \vec p \to \Sigma^+ \Theta^+$ which was recently proposed to determine unambiguously the parity of $\Theta^+$. Within theoretical uncertainties cross sections for the allowed spin configuration are estimated; it is of order of one microbarn for the positive parity $\Theta^+$ and about 1/10 microbarn for the negative parity $\Theta^+$ in the threshold energy region where the s-wave component dominates.
